Transaction 64caeea1fc6b8e148def5e1ee176feeb7ecdc9a11771a93b3dbcff3a6f07c428

1 Input
2 Outputs
  • 64caeea1fc6b8e148def5e1ee176feeb7ecdc9a11771a93b3dbcff3a6f07c428:0
  • value  657890
    address  3DKPdtJKV4Fw763H7BDB1JvuSR5DPgb5Kz
  • 64caeea1fc6b8e148def5e1ee176feeb7ecdc9a11771a93b3dbcff3a6f07c428:1
  • value  883344254
    address  1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q